The 46-year-old man died at the time of the accident. The injured passengers were taken to a nearby hospital and released hours later.
This morning there was a tragic accidentat kilometer 185 of route 2: the driver of a long-distance bus died after suffering cardiac arrest while driving, the The vehicle fell into the ditch and 14 people were injured.

The incident occurred at the height of the game Castelli, in the middle of the route that the PlataBus double-decker bus made between La Plata and Miramar.


Local authorities quickly arrived at the scene, along with personnel from the Aubasa concessionaire, Civil Defense teams, emergency services and several crews from the Castelli Volunteer Firefighters to assist the victims and secure the area.
The injured were transferred to the Municipal Hospital “Dr. Ramón Carrillo” to receive medical attention. They were already discharged around 3 in the morning, since none of them had serious injuries.
Christian Oscar Silva Fortino, The 46-year-old driver was the only fatal victim. According to police sources, he had no visible injuries and His death occurred due to a heart attack. I was traveling with a 50-year-old companion.
Due to the accident, Highways of Buenos Aires (Aubasa) initially reported the closure of the route in the direction of Mar del Plata, but after noon he updated it to a “road reduction“.
